What are the most common Mazda repair issues for drivers in the Nicolaus area?

Common issues for local Mazdas include suspension wear from rural road conditions, air conditioning system strain due to the hot valley summers, and for older models, potential rust concerns. Regular maintenance is key to addressing these climate and terrain-specific challenges.

When should I seek service for my Mazda's check engine light around Nicolaus?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ance loss, as driving on rural routes like Highway 99 with an unresolved major issue can lead to a breakdown.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ly at a local shop to prevent a minor issue from becoming a costly repair.

What local driving conditions in Nicolaus should influence my Mazda's maintenance schedule?

The combination of summer heat, agricultural dust, and rough country roads means you should pay extra attention to coolant system flushes, air filter changes, and tire and suspension inspections. Adhering to the severe service schedule in your owner's manual is recommended for these conditions.
